We offer a complete package of facilities services, including HVAC, mechanical and electrical construction services, engineering, design, installation, repair and maintenance.Why join us? 401k, Profit Sharing Retirement Plan Tuition Reimbursement Program HSA, FSA, Dependent Care Flex Spending Acct Life, AD&D, & AFLAC Plans Paid Vacation/Sick leave/HolidaysJob DetailsHVAC Chiller Service Technician to perform maintenance, repairs, modification and troubleshooting of primarily centrifugal, screw, reciprocating and scroll, air cooled and water cooled chillers, refrigeration equipment, boilers (water/steam) and unitary HVAC equipment.Responsibilities:Performs routine and preventative maintenance on chiller and boiler unit’s electrical and mechanical components. This includes:oSupporting equipment such as chillers, compressors, purge units, cooling towers, pumps/motors, valves, boilers, and unitary equipment.oExcellent record keeping, including refrigeration and operation logs.oChiller/boiler components, refrigeration units and supporting equipment, meters, relays, sensors, analog, VFD’s, switches, controllers, gauges, thermostats and other similar devices.Performs major repairs on chillers and boilers. This includes:oFollowing all EPA guidelines in recovering refrigerant, replacement of O-rings, gaskets, seals and bearings, sleeve Babbitt, thrust/counterthrust and roller bearings.oPerforms boiler inspections and PM teardowns per current state of CT code guidelinesPerforms work on cooling tower gear boxes, drive couplings, intermediate shafts, fan blade pitches and centrifugal pumpsAbility to work on the following equipment brands: Trane, Carrier, York, Daikin, Smardt and McQuay Centrifugal, Reciprocating, and Screw Chillers.Ability to work on the following equipment brands: Cleaver Brooks, Hurst, Lochinvar, Fulton, HB Smith, and Patterson Kelly.Utilizes CFC and HCFC refrigerant recovery equipment, maintains records and performs all service and maintenance repairs in accordance with current EPA regulations.SkillsHigh School diploma or equivalent- Any D1, S1 or S2 licensure is idealPost-secondary vocational or technical school diploma in HVAC or Refrigeration from an accredited Institution required OR a recognized apprenticeship program. but not limited to service and operation as well as tear down3-5 years minimum experience working on commercial units Must have a clean driving recordBoiler and steam experience a plusEPA CertifiedInterested in hearing more?
